| #include <stdio.h> |
| #include <stdlib.h> |
| #include "gmp-impl.h" |
| #include "tests.h" |
| |
| |
| /* Usage: t-lucnum_ui [n] |
| |
| Test up to L[n], or if n is omitted then the default limit below. A |
| literal "x" for the limit means continue forever, this being meant only |
| for development. */ |
| |
| |
| void |
| check_sequence (int argc, char *argv[]) |
| { |
| unsigned long n; |
| unsigned long limit = 100 * GMP_LIMB_BITS; |
| mpz_t want_ln, want_ln1, got_ln, got_ln1; |
| |
| if (argc > 1 && argv[1][0] == 'x') |
| limit = ULONG_MAX; |
| else |
| TESTS_REPS (limit, argv, argc); |
| |
| /* start at n==0 */ |
| mpz_init_set_si (want_ln1, -1); /* L[-1] */ |
| mpz_init_set_ui (want_ln, 2); /* L[0] */ |
| mpz_init (got_ln); |
| mpz_init (got_ln1); |
| |
| for (n = 0; n < limit; n++) |
| { |
| mpz_lucnum2_ui (got_ln, got_ln1, n); |
| MPZ_CHECK_FORMAT (got_ln); |
| MPZ_CHECK_FORMAT (got_ln1); |
| if (mpz_cmp (got_ln, want_ln) != 0 || mpz_cmp (got_ln1, want_ln1) != 0) |
| { |
| printf ("mpz_lucnum2_ui(%lu) wrong\n", n); |
| mpz_trace ("want ln ", want_ln); |
| mpz_trace ("got ln ", got_ln); |
| mpz_trace ("want ln1", want_ln1); |
| mpz_trace ("got ln1", got_ln1); |
| abort (); |
| } |
| |
| mpz_lucnum_ui (got_ln, n); |
| MPZ_CHECK_FORMAT (got_ln); |
| if (mpz_cmp (got_ln, want_ln) != 0) |
| { |
| printf ("mpz_lucnum_ui(%lu) wrong\n", n); |
| mpz_trace ("want ln", want_ln); |
| mpz_trace ("got ln", got_ln); |
| abort (); |
| } |
| |
| mpz_add (want_ln1, want_ln1, want_ln); /* L[n+1] = L[n] + L[n-1] */ |
| mpz_swap (want_ln1, want_ln); |
| } |
| |
| mpz_clear (want_ln); |
| mpz_clear (want_ln1); |
| mpz_clear (got_ln); |
| mpz_clear (got_ln1); |
| } |
| |
| int |
| main (int argc, char *argv[]) |
| { |
| tests_start (); |
| mp_trace_base = -16; |
| |
| check_sequence (argc, argv); |
| |
| tests_end (); |
| exit (0); |
| } |
